Dubai-Bound Passenger Caught With 5,342 ATM Cards In Kano
The Nigeria Customs Service, NCS, Kano Command has arrested a Dubai-Bound passenger in possession of 5,342 ATM cards at the Malam Aminu Kano International Airport, Kano. The Customs Area Comptroller, Mr Nasir Ahmed, made this known on Wednesday in Kano, NAN reports. Ahmed said the suspect was arrested while about to board a Dubai-bound Ethiopian Airlines flight with the ATM cards...
Two-Storey Accident And Emergency Building In FMC Umuahia Collapses (Photos, Video)
A two-storey modern Accident and Emergency building under construction at Federal Medical Centre, FMC Umuahia Abia State has collapsed. The building ABN TV gathered collapsed at about 1am on Thursday. Our correspondent learnt that no human casualty was recorded. Man Who Slept With Biological Mother, Had 3 Kids With Her In Kwara Finally Arrested
Operatives of the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ps in Kwara State have arrested an immigrant from Benin Republic, Adamu Sime, for allegedly having carnal knowledge of his biological mother.
